PK Education are working with a Barnsley secondary school who are looking to appoint a Science Teacher on a permanent basis from September 2026. This is a school that has made significant progress over recent years, with a clear focus on raising standards and improving outcomes. Leadership is visible and supportive, and there is a strong emphasis on consistency across the school.
The Science department is well‑resourced, with dedicated labs and a clear scheme of work in place. Practical learning is a key focus, and there is good support from technicians, allowing teachers to deliver engaging, hands‑on lessons. You will be teaching Science across KS3 and KS4, with flexibility around specialism (Biology, Chemistry or Physics).
This role suits someone who:
- Wants to be part of a developing school
- Is confident delivering structured and practical lessons
- Can contribute to a positive and focused department
